Default How to make a 02 Lid fit on a 99 LS1

So I just bought a lid off of a 02 ls1 and I've got a 99. I know that you have to do something to the AIR hold if I'm correct. Is their a writeup on it or can one of you guys explain exactly what you have to do? I would search for it, but my search doesn't work for my computer(not sure why).

The lids should be the same besides the AIR. You could just install a rubber plug in the lid.

just go to your local parts store and buy a rubber grommet,dont forget to take your lid in the store so you know exactly what size.I found mine at autozone
